Mark,

Activity renumbering will not work if the activity ID  has and activity strucrure, and by itself mean something; for example

TP103300R0, activity structures is X-XX-XXX-XX-XX

for this example  T=Terminal; P1=Podium 1, 033= CSI (concrete), 00 = sequential number R0 = Rev 0

 

If you can do export import, then it is fairly easy, and this process will not disturb the activity relationships:

1) Create a User Defined Field under the Enterprise, User Define Fields, attribute as Text, Let say you assign the User Define Field as NewID.

2) Create an export file (excel) with the fields, Activity ID, WBS, Activity Status and NewID.  In excel, open you export, which should show the columns Activity ID, WBS, Activity Status and New ID, together with the data. Of course the New ID is still blank.

3) Under the NewID, indicate the new id corresponding to the original activity ID in your programme. You can of course use VLOOKUP in excel to make it easier.

4) Save this file.

5) Import this file to P6.

6) Using Global change, you can then set the criteria Activity ID = NewID in the global change parameters.

7) Run and commit the change. P6 will re ID your programme with the new acitivity IDs and still maintain the relationships between this new IDs similar to the relationships between the activities using the original IDs.

DONE.

There is no easy way to change the Activity ID especially if you are using p6 V6.2, you can use renumbering ACTIVITY ID in the higher version of Primavera. But in P6 v6.2 and lower, you can use the global change. *go to tools, global change, new. and then, in the "if" parameter, Where - use WBS  is under select the acitivities in the WBS you want to change. and in the "then" parameter select the activity = custom (write the activity codes you want) and then lick change, dnt commit changes, and exit the global change, I hope this can help you.

Hi Mark

In P6 ,go to Edit and select tab "renumber activities". Follow the instructions. I use this funtion frequently to create "intelligent" id coding.

Say, you have activities with the same discriptions but thes are in different WBS sections or on different fases of the work. Then it is advisable to renumber the activities to match the different fases to make sure that you can recognise the activities when you apply filters .
